French Iron Armillary
About the Item
This antique French Iron Armillary, dating back to the 1920s, is a stunning piece of craftsmanship. Made entirely out of iron, it boasts a large size and intricate design. As a decorative and historical piece, it is the perfect addition to any home or collection.
- Dimensions:Height: 55 in (139.7 cm)Diameter: 53.5 in (135.89 cm)
